Soil and Rock Mechanics, Dynamics and Structures, Foundation Engineering and Geology - A Civil Engineering Course under the National Programme on Technology Enhanced Learning

Enhancing the Civil Engineering Course on subjects of soil rock mechanics, dynamics and structures, foundation engineering and geology.

This Civil Engineering Course under the National Programme on Technology Enhanced Learning (NPTEL) on the broad subject of  Soil and Rock Mechanics, Dynamics and Structures, Foundation Engineering and Geology is being carried out by Indian Institute of Technology’s and the Indian Institute of Science, Bangalore as a collaborative project supported by the Ministry of Human Resource Development (Government of India) to enhance the quality of engineering education in the country, by developing curriculum based video and web courses. In these web based lectures, the authors have developed the subject in detail and in stages in a student-friendly manner. The broad group of Soil and Rock Mechanics, Dynamics and Structures, Foundation Engineering and Geology is structured into modules on the following topics:

Engineering Geology

This course by IIT Kharagpur deals with the application of geology to engineering practice so as to ensure that the geologic factors affecting the location, design, construction, operation and maintenance of engineering works are based on geologic and geotechnical recommendations. The lectures deal with geologic structures, geologic maps and stratigraphic sections apart from application of remote sensing in engineering geology.  The course lectures can be viewed at the NPTEL website here

Foundation Engineering

This course by IIT Bombay deals with the design of foundation which requires the consideration of many essential factors with regard to soil data, geology of the site, land use patterns, ground conditions and the type of structure to be built. A detailed understanding of the field situation is also very important apart from theoretical knowledge of the subject. It seeks to provide an overview of the essential features of foundation design. The different aspects of foundation engineering ranging from soil exploration to the design of different types of foundation, including the ground improvement measures to be taken for poor soil conditions have been covered. Soil Mechanics

The course by IIT Guwahati introduces the basic principles of engineering behaviour of soils. More specifically, it deals with (a) engineering classification of a given soil (b) understanding the principle of effective stress, and then calculating stresses that influence soil behaviour (c) calculating water flow through ground, and understanding the effects of seepage on the stability of structures (d) determining soil deformation parameters, and calculating settlement magnitude and rate of settlement (e) specifying soil compaction requirements and (f) conducting laboratory tests, and obtaining soil properties and parameters from the test observations and results.

Advanced Geotechnical Engineering

The course by IIT Guwahati builds on the fundamental concepts of Soil Mechanics to provide more generalized formulations and their applications for both in-depth understanding of soil response and design of geotechnical structures. The course begins with origin and nature of soils to establish its link with the expected mechanical response of soil. It covers the mechanics of fluid flow through porous media, derivation of permeability, governing laws and their limitations, Laplace equation and its application to 2-D and 3-D problems in geotechnical engineering. In the application of learned concepts, the course concludes with various methods of short term and long term analysis of slope stability, reliability analysis for slope stability, and analysis of loads on the buried structures. Soil Dynamics

This course by IIT Roorkee is aimed to bring out the advanced theories and practical knowledge of soil dynamics. It involves detailed design of foundations for machines like reciprocating engines and impact hammers in a simple lucid language. Other topics like theory of vibrations, dynamic soil properties, dynamic earth pressures, pile foundations under dynamic loads, liquefaction of soil, machine foundations and vibration isolations are also covered. Rock Mechanics

This course by IIT Madras provides basic knowledge of Rock Mechanics and helps understand the design aspects of various structures in/on rock like tunnels and other underground openings, slopes etc. The aim is to provide a comprehensive understanding of the rock engineering subject, including determination of physicomechanical properties of intact rock and rock mass, rock discontinuities, stresses and deformations around the excavation, insitu stresses and failure mechanisms in rocks. The course details can be viewed at the NPTEL website here

Ground Improvement Techniques

This course by IIT Kanpur covers engineering properties of soft, weak and compressible deposits, principles of treatment-loading (static and dynamic), accelerated flow, reinforcement, vertical drains, granular piles, soil nailing and anchors. It helps devise alternative solutions to difficult and earth construction problems and in evaluating their effectiveness before, during and after construction. The course syllabus can be viewed at the NPTEL website here
